Not as difficult a feat as you might imagine. Consider that the target you're actually shooting at is twice the diameter of the bullet. Ie: if a .308 bullet is used you can be off as much as almost .300" on either side of the blade edge- it only takes the tiniest of slivers to break the balloon on the opposite side of the blade from the main chunk of the bullet. That adds up to a target .6" wide. Not terribly difficult with an accurate rifle.
